Eligibility Criteria for Indian Navy SSR/MR 2025
- Educational Qualification
- SSR (Senior Secondary Recruit): Candidates must have passed 10+2 with Maths and Physics and at least one of these subjects: Chemistry, Biology or Computer Science from a recognized board.
- MR (Matriculation Recruitment): Candidates must have passed 10th (Matriculation) from a recognized board.
- Age Limit
- Candidates must be born between 01 August 2004 to 31 July 2008 (exact dates will be confirmed in the official notification).
- Nationality
- Candidates must be Indian citizens.
Selection Process for Indian Navy SSR/MR 2025
The selection process for Indian Navy SSR/MR 2025 comprises of the following stages:
- Written Exam –Objective-type questions based on Mathematics, Science, English and General Knowledge.
- Physical Fitness Test (PFT) –To assess the physical stamina and fitness level of the candidates.
- Medical Examination –Conducted to ensure that the candidates meet the required medical standards.
Medical Standards for Indian Navy SSR/MR 2025
- Height: Minimum 157 cm (Male), 152 cm (Female)
- Vision:Minimum 6/6 (without glasses) in better eye and 6/9 in worse eye
- Chest Expansion:Minimum 5 cm expansion
Indian Navy SSR/MR Salary and Benefits
Pay Scale
Designation | Monthly Salary |
SSR | ₹21,700 – ₹69,100 (Level 3) + MSP ₹5,200 |
MR | ₹21,700 – ₹69,100 (Level 3) + MSP ₹5,200 |
Additional Benefits
- Free accommodation, food and medical facilities
- Annual leave and travel allowances
- Pension and gratuity after retirement
- Promotion and career growth opportunities
